2. Overview of the national standard thickness standard specification for galvanized steel pipe
According to the national standards GB/T 3091-2015 “Welded Steel Pipe” and GB/T 9711.1-2011 “Steel Pipe for Petroleum and Natural Gas Industry”, the thickness of galvanized steel pipes shall meet the following requirements:
- The wall thickness of galvanized steel pipes shall be within the specified range, generally between 0.8mm and 2.5mm. In special cases, it can be adjusted according to specific needs.
- The average weight of the galvanized layer should meet the specified requirements, usually between 60g/m² and 600g/m². The greater the weight of the galvanized layer, the better the corrosion resistance of the galvanized steel pipe.
- The inner and outer surfaces of the galvanized steel pipe should be smooth, without defects such as wrinkles, cracks, bubbles, etc. At the same time, the galvanized layer should be firmly attached to the surface of the steel pipe and not easy to peel off.

3. The use temperature limit of galvanized steel pipe
The use temperature limit of galvanized steel pipe refers to the temperature range within which the galvanized steel pipe can work normally without deformation, cracking, or failure. According to international standards and industry practices, the use temperature limit of galvanized steel pipe is as follows:
- In general, the use temperature range of galvanized steel pipe is between -40℃ and 200℃.
- If used in special environments, such as high temperature, low temperature, or corrosive environment, it is necessary to select the appropriate galvanized steel pipe material and thickness according to the specific situation.
- When using galvanized steel pipe, pay attention to controlling the temperature to avoid exceeding its use temperature limit, so as not to affect the performance and life of the steel pipe.

4. Advantages and application fields of galvanized steel pipes
Galvanized steel pipes have the following advantages, which make them widely used in the construction, engineering, and manufacturing industries:
- Strong corrosion resistance: The galvanized layer can effectively prevent the steel pipe from being oxidized, corroded, and rusted, and extend the service life of the steel pipe.
- Good welding performance: The galvanized steel pipe has good welding performance and can be easily connected and installed.
- Economic and practical: The price of galvanized steel pipes is relatively low, cost-effective, and suitable for large-scale use.

Galvanized steel pipes are mainly used in building structures, pipeline transportation, machinery manufacturing, and other fields. In the construction field, galvanized steel pipes are often used to build frame structures, and install pipelines and ventilation systems. In the field of pipeline transportation, galvanized steel pipes can be used to transport liquids, gases, and solid particles. In the field of machinery manufacturing, galvanized steel pipes are often used to make mechanical parts and equipment.
